VIVA SUNITA
by AMITABH SINHA & LOLITA SARKAR - Best Direction

Awarded Director
Amitabh Sinha                                      

We direct commercials. Usually. A lot of people's views have to be taken on board... The idea of an independent project, or at least a personal interpretation of a communication is tempting stuff.

Question when making film is: What is 'something to say'? What should one talk about when one 'talks about oneself'? So you wait...

Calvino is no mere writer - he has the precision of a surgeon and a poet. The pictures, the idea, the narrative... are all... very clear.

We can't talk about our own sensibility with any real success, but we tried to follow something Calvino said after decades of writing, which caught our fancy - he said he'd spent forever learning what to leave out.

Devang Vyas at Fuji India gave us 16mm film stock, Vishal Sinha, our cinematographer 'lent' us his camera and his services. Lights were provided free by Mulchand at Lights & Grips. Almost all the actors did not charge for their work.

Awarded Director
                                      Lolita Sarkar

And thanks to these kindnesses - the film you see.

It would be fey to make deep directorial comments on this film.

Our gratitude to the story.
Our hope is we didn't mangle it too much.

And on that note? phew, thanks!

Amitabh Sinha & Lolita Sarkar

BOARD OF DEATH
by ALASTAIR FERRAN - Special Mention

Special Mention
Board of Death                                        

When scientist Jack Graham returns from the jungles of Peru, he has a new leap in pharmaceutical medicine in his possession.

Hunted by those who will stop at nothing to get their hands on it, he is pursued by a pair of hired assassins named Mr Smith and Mr Jones.

 

 

Awarded Director
                                    Alastair Ferran

Board of Death is an action film and not afraid to show it.

When creating the film I wanted to create a film for nothing that had that 'wow' factor of all the action films I grew up with as a kid and at the same time to thrill without sacrificing intelligence, character or wit.

Alastair Ferran
Director

The Annual Program Without Frontiers granted again its Award at the 23rd Mar del Plata International Film Festival

Carlos Martinez and Bou Grasso
23rd Mar del Plata Film Festival - Awards Ceremony

The Annual Program Without Frontiers Award has been granted in the two former editions of this A Class FIAPF Film Festival, and it has accomplished it's goal: the Argentinean directors who won, Cristobal Braun Mesples in 2006, and Fermin Valeros in 2007, got a strong international recognition as well as support for their next projects.

Once again, it is an honour for our institution to give out  our Award to The Employment, directed by Santiago "Bou" Grasso and a Special Mention to Shout, by Andrés Denegri at the 23rd Mar del Plata International Film Festival. It includes the Official Program Diploma, and also the automatic selection for the 2009 editions of the San Francisco Short Film Festival and the Festival du Cinema de Paris, in accordance with the decision of the Official Competition Jury.

Carlos Martinez
Director of the Annual Program Without Frontiers
